The Top 8 Must-See Museums In The World That You Should See

There is something about museums that we just love and there are hundreds and hundreds of museums around the world. This means there is no shortage of museums for you to check out, but you’ll want to know what some of the best ones are. We have put together a list of the top eight museums around the world and what they are known for. With that said, continue to read on to find out what museums made it onto our list.

NYC: The Museum of Modern Art

Located in New York City is the Museum of Modern Art, which is also known as the MoMa.

Some of the most popular artworks in the world can be found here, including work from artists such as Warhol, Van Gogh and Matisse to name a few. The museum is massive, so be prepared to spend a few hours there.

Paris: Musée du Louvre

If there is only one attraction you have time to see in Paris, make sure it is the Musee du Louvre museum. It is one of the top museums in the world. It doubles as both a museum and a palace. While inside there, you’ll have the chance to view Egyptian relics, sculptures and many antiquities from the Mesopotamian period.

Vatican City: Vatican Museums

When you find yourself in Italy, do head over to Vatican City. The Vatican Museums houses many high quality artworks, and this includes a number of statues. The museums houses gorgeous paintings too.

London UK: The Design Museum

The Design Museum in London is fairly new, as it opened for business back at the end of 2016.

This is this is the place to visit if you’re a fan of contemporary design. There is an array of exhibitions, both permanent and temporary that you can check out while there.

Madrid: Prado Museum

One of the best museums in the world is the Prado Museum in Madrid. The museum is well-known for its collections of European art, especially art from the 12th century. You’ll have the chance to view a number of Flemish and Italian pieces, as well as paintings from some of the best known artists of all time, including Bosch and Titian to name a few.

Florence: Galleria degli Uffizi

In Florence Italy is where you’ll find the Galleria degli Uffizi art museum. It has been designated as a museum since 1865 and it is one of the most visited attractions in the city, as well as one of the most popular art museums in the world. If you want to view amazing pieces of art, then make sure you check out the Galleria degli Uffizi in Florence.

Zagreb: Museum of Broken Relationships

Over in Croatia is where you’ll find a unique, but popular museum. It is called the Museum of Broken Relationships. The displays you’ll find here are unique because a love story accompanies them, hence the name. If you ever find yourself in Zagreb, then do be sure to pay a visit to the Museum of Broken Relationships.

Stockholm: Vasa Museum

This museum is housed in a ship that has been preserved. The ship sank back in 1628, but was rebuilt and turned into a museum. It is now one of the most unique and popular museums in the world.

8 Of The Best Beaches On The Planet

For those who are planning their next vacation one sort of destination is always going to be part of any bucket list – that is a location that boasts a fantastic beach. Beach holidays are the perfect getaway for those who are traveling alone wishing to meet new people, as a couple wanting a romantic getaway or as a family. There are just so many activities to enjoy at the salt water. For those who simply want to lie back and recharge tired phisical and emotional batteries to those who want to explore some of the most beautiful places in the world a beach holiday ticks all the boxes.

But with so much choice how does one identify that perfect beach spot? It may be challenging – but here are 8 great choices to consider.

Seagrass Bay on Laucala Island, Fiji.

If you want solitude and are prepared to pay for the privilege then Seagrass Bay is the perfect location. Located on a seven and a half mile square island, Seagrass Bay is accessed by a short plane hop from Nadi .

This is an island paradise in all senses of the world. Carpeted in lush tropical jungle and home to stunning bird and other flora and fauna – as well as spectacular marine life it is a retreat for those who want to immerse themselves in nature.

Sunset Beach in Oahu, Hawaii.

If you enjoy big wave action offshore and sparkling, pristine sands onshore then this is the place where you need to be. The water is often incredibly calm when the waves are not suitable for surfing, making in a prime spot for those who want to snorkel. However the claim to fame of this beach is the sunsets. Grab a picnic basket, a bottle of something delicious and take your seat for one of nature’s greatest spectacles.

Banana Beach on Koh Hey Island in Phuket, Thailand.

Phuket is rightly recognized as one of the most beautiful spots in the world and Banana Beach is at the top of what is already a collection of the most spectacular collection of beaches in the world. Crystal clear water, lush jungle canopy and part of a National Park and marine preservation area. Laid back and with great snorkeling, kayaking and parasailing this is a place where the worries of the world can be left far behind. The bamboo frame restaurant also serves some of the best seafood in the world.

Clifton 4th Beach, Cape Town, South Africa

Clifton 4th beach is nestled in a protected nook on the Atlantic coast in Cape Town, South Africa. The beautiful white sand of the beach makes it the perfect sunbathing and beach activities location while exploring South Africa.

In summer it is protected from the South East wind which is perfect for summer beaching. You can even get Sushi Delivery right to the beach.

Psarou Beach on Mykonos, Greece.

Mykonos has long been a favorite with international travelers and boasts some of the world’s greatest beaches. Psarou beach however takes it to a whole new level. It’s petite size and the fact that it is set in a magnificent horseshoe bay make it worthy of acclaim. Add to this the numerous fabulous dining destinations and great water sports opportunities and you have the recipe for a great beach experience.

Palm Beach in Aruba.

Only two miles in length – but a world of relaxation. This is the destination for those who want to spend the day in the sunshine on sparkling sands and spend the evening at the casino or dining at one of the many great restaurants in the area. After that it’s off to enjoy the pulsating beats at one of the many nightclubs in the area.

Matira Beach on Bora Bora, French Polynesia.

Bora Bora is a legendary place for those who really want to experience island style relaxation – and Matira Beach takes the possibilities to a whole new level. Powdery sands and a lagoon that teams with marine life mean that water based fun is the name of the game. Palm fringed public access means no sky high resort type pricing.

Reethi Rah – North Malé Atoll, Maldives.

With over 1,200 beaches to choose from in the Maldives finding your own slice of paradise may not be difficult. But Reethi Rah really shines. It boasts 8 separate opportunities to throw off the worries of the world at the edge of unspoiled and crystal clear waters. Only one resort means that you are almost assured that you will not be part of the madding crowd.
